Bush Hogging Service in Prince Georges County, MD

Bush hogging services involve the use of heavy-duty equipment to clear overgrown fields, pastures, or large areas of property by cutting down tall grasses, weeds, and brush. This service is often requested for maintaining open land, preparing fields for planting or grazing, or managing unruly vegetation on large residential or commercial properties.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of the project, including the size of the area to be cleared, the type of vegetation involved, and any potential obstacles that could affect the work.

Before requesting bush hogging, property owners should consider the terrain and accessibility of the area, as well as any local regulations or restrictions related to land clearing. It’s also helpful to communicate the desired outcome-whether for aesthetic purposes, land management, or future use-to ensure the service aligns with specific property needs. Proper planning can help achieve a clean, well-maintained landscape suitable for various property uses.

Common Bush Hogging Service Jobs

Field clearing - removing overgrown brush and tall grass to prepare land for new projects.

Fence line maintenance - trimming along property boundaries for neatness and access.

Pasture upkeep - maintaining grass height for grazing animals or agricultural use.

Unwanted vegetation removal - clearing invasive plants to improve landscape appearance.

Driveway and pathway clearing - trimming grass and debris to keep paths accessible.

Property tidying - managing overgrowth to enhance curb appeal and safety.

Bush Hogging Service Questions

What is bush hogging service? Bush hogging is a land clearing method that involves using heavy-duty equipment to cut tall grass, weeds, and brush across large areas of property.

What types of properties benefit from bush hogging? Properties with overgrown fields, vacant lots, pasture land, or wooded areas often require bush hogging to maintain accessibility and appearance.

Is bush hogging suitable for uneven terrain? Yes, bush hogging equipment can handle uneven and rough terrain, making it effective for clearing difficult or inaccessible areas.

What should property owners consider before scheduling bush hogging? It's important to assess the area for rocks, debris, or obstacles that could affect equipment operation and safety during the process.
